DomoSapien:   Last season we had a Guide contest for Frontline. Click that link and check out the guides in that thread, as they may be helpful.
The best way to min/max your profits in FL:

1) Run Credit Boosters (If you don't have any credit boosters you can still participate in the February Scavenger Hunt and earn a bunch of credit + XP boosters in the beginning of March!)
2) Run Clan Credit Boosters (Clan boosters are just one of the benefits of joining an active clan) 3) Run Premium Tanks - Premiums have a higher Credit-earning coefficient, and this applies to Frontline battles as well. 4) Run non-premium consumables and fire non-premium rounds. The more tanks you use in FL, the more consumables you will be charged for. Once you use a consumable on a tank, using that same consumable on that same tank won't double-charge you for resupply. 5) Making Major or General should be your objective for each battle. You get bonuses based on the FL rank you reach in each battle, and you get bonuses for capturing objectives, resetting base capture, or being in a sector that is succesfully captured on offense. If your vehicle has good mobility, you can flex between lanes as they are about to be captured to grab some extra XP towards your FL rank.
